Need to kill Outlook

#1 Post by jronald » Wed Aug 31, 2011 11:27 am

Im leaving a company and need to kill my personal Outlook folders. This is not an Exchange Server if it matters. How do I do it?

Re: Need to kill Outlook

#3 Post by RealBlackStuff » Wed Aug 31, 2011 12:02 pm

If that company is halfway decent, they would have plenty of backup copies.
But if it's on a PC or laptop, and there's no backup plan, copy the .pst file onto a USB-stick, then rename it to something inconspicuous (like howtorepairtoasters.doc), then delete that doc file.
Then create a new .pst file in Outlook with one harmless email in it or so.

Re: Need to kill Outlook

#6 Post by ArtShapiro » Wed Aug 31, 2011 6:29 pm

jronald wrote:Not finding a .pst file under 7. Im familiar with how to do it in XP with the .pst file.
Ron
It's most assuredly there. Go to the "Mail (32 bit)" icon in Control Panel and use the "Data Files" button to see where the pst file(s) resides.
